Transaction 83fc6ac55e3924e09d25278dd150e33c5f285c931f2dbae8d0d79f4418752a92
1 Input
1 Output
-
83fc6ac55e3924e09d25278dd150e33c5f285c931f2dbae8d0d79f4418752a92:0
- value
- 673205
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 50f0849fc86bf09a88175966c0a99cda6485fda6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18NyBqQ2BfdKE87oQGR3Q4DcezwPHvCXVV